What to check before for pre-war buildings near the M100 bus in South Harlem

  • Expect older building stock: confirm heating, hot-water setup, elevator status (if applicable), and the most recent maintenance notes directly with the landlord or super.
  • Use the rated-building score as a starting point (not a guarantee). Read what’s behind it, then ask how issues are handled when they come up.
  • Ask about move-in costs beyond rent, since pre-war buildings often have different deposit and fee practices.
  • If a unit is currently advertised, verify availability dates, lease start flexibility, and any restrictions that could affect your schedule.
  • Before signing, request written answers on utilities responsibility, parking access (if needed), and any current building rules that could affect day-to-day living.
